Ornery and Hornery posted:

What are greater rifts and why are they great

They're basically NMDs but no loot will drop during the run in exchange for one big drop of a minimum guaranteed quality based on difficulty when you kill the boss.

Mustached Demon
Nov 12, 2016

Greater rifts have a time limit component too for leveling up a leggo gem. Similar to the glyph level up at the end.
